Common Vehicle Problems We See in Mooresville

Daily driving around Mooresville means your vehicle is fighting clay, chemicals, insects, and tree debris across every season without much of a break. The combination of rural back roads, heavy commuter miles on state routes, and humid summers creates a lineup of problems that stack on top of each other faster than most drivers realize.

🌿 Pollen Coating

Where it shows up: Hood, roof, trunk lid, windshield, and any horizontal surface. Mooresville's pollen season hits early and hard, and the humidity that follows turns a light dusting into a textured film that etches into clear coat if it sits through a few rain cycles. Drivers commuting north on SR-67 every morning are rolling through pollen corridors that reload the car before they even get to the highway.

🧂 Road Salt Buildup

Where it shows up: Rocker panels, wheel arches, undercarriage, and lower door edges. Every winter commute on I-70 or SR-67 deposits another layer of corrosive brine along the bottom of your vehicle where it's hardest to see and easiest to ignore. Left unchecked through a Mooresville winter, that salt works into seams and starts the kind of rust that doesn't show up until it's already a real problem.

🪱 Mud in Carpets

Where it shows up: Front and rear floor mats, cargo area, and seat bases. Anyone pulling into a clay driveway after rain or unloading at a muddy boat launch is tracking that Morgan County clay straight into the cab of their truck or SUV. It grinds into carpet fibers as it dries, and by the time it looks like just a little dirt, it's already embedded well past what a vacuum can reach.

🐛 Bug Splatter

Where it shows up: Front bumper, hood leading edge, grille, and windshield lower strip. Summer evening drives along SR-144 or out on rural two-lanes turn your front end into a bug graveyard, and the longer that splatter bakes in Indiana heat, the harder it bonds to your paint. Pickup and SUV owners with a lot of highway miles between Mooresville and Indianapolis accumulate the worst of it across the front clip.

🌲 Tree Sap

Where it shows up: Roof, hood, and anywhere you park under shade trees. Mooresville neighborhoods with mature tree coverage are great for summer shade and brutal for paint, dropping sap that starts clear and turns into a hardened, paint-damaging residue within days. Minivans and SUVs parked in residential driveways under oaks or maples are especially vulnerable through late spring and into early summer.

💧 Hard Water Spots

Where it shows up: Windows, painted panels, and chrome or gloss trim. Indiana tap water leaves mineral deposits every time a sprinkler clips your car or a rainstorm evaporates off a hot surface in the summer sun. Around Mooresville, vehicles that get rinsed but not properly dried end up with cloudy, etched water spots that make clean paint look dull and neglected.

Mooresville Seasonal Car Detailing Guide

Living in Mooresville means your vehicle cycles through four genuinely distinct seasons, and each one deposits something different on the paint, into the interior, and under the wheel wells. Keeping up with that progression is the difference between a vehicle that holds its value and one that shows every mile it's traveled.

Winter

INDOT brine and road salt treatments on SR-67 and the I-70 approaches coat the undercarriage and lower panels of every vehicle making the Mooresville commute between November and March. That chemical film works into paint seams and wheel wells long after the road dries, accelerating rust and dulling the finish if it isn't fully removed. A post-winter detail strips that residue before it has months of spring humidity to do further damage.

Spring

Morgan County's clay-heavy soils turn every unpaved driveway and muddy shoulder into a source of reddish-brown contamination that sticks to wheel wells, rocker panels, and floor mats with real determination. Spring tree pollen adds a second layer — a fine yellow coating that settles into every horizontal surface and works into clear coat if it sits through repeated wet-dry cycles. A thorough spring detail addresses both at once, giving your paint and interior a clean starting point before summer heat sets in.

Summer

The commute up SR-67 toward Indianapolis on a humid July morning means a windshield and front fascia collecting bug splatter at highway speeds, and summer heat bakes that protein residue into the paint faster than most drivers realize. High humidity inside a closed vehicle encourages odors to develop in carpet and upholstery, especially in vehicles that carry wet gear, kids, or dogs. A mid-summer detail removes the exterior splatter and freshens the interior before the buildup compounds through the rest of the season.

Fall

Fall in Mooresville brings leaf debris collecting in hood cowls, door jambs, and sunroof drains — organic material that holds moisture and can stain paint or block drainage if ignored. Early frost events leave water mineral deposits on glass and painted surfaces as temperatures swing through the day. A fall detail clears that debris and applies protective product before winter road treatment season begins again.

Do you clean leather seats?

Yes — leather seat cleaning and conditioning is included in our interior detail packages. We use pH-balanced leather cleaners and conditioners that lift grime without drying or cracking the leather, keeping your seats supple and protected.

Do you shampoo cloth seats and carpets?

Yes — our interior detail service includes hot-water extraction shampooing of cloth seats and carpets. This process deep-cleans fibers rather than just surface cleaning, which is especially important for Mooresville vehicles dealing with clay mud and heavy seasonal use.

Do you clean exterior wheels and tires?

Yes — wheels and tires are part of our exterior detail service. We degrease brake dust from wheels, scrub tires clean, and apply a tire dressing for a finished look that holds up against Mooresville's road grime and wet clay splatter.
